Anurag Jain Appointed CEO of NITI Aayog (22 July 2026)
Senior IAS officer Anurag Jain has been appointed as the new Chief Executive Officer (CEO) of NITI Aayog, succeeding B.V.R. Subrahmanyam.
- Anurag Jain, a 1989-batch IAS officer of the Madhya Pradesh cadre, takes charge as the NITI Aayog CEO.
- He previously served as Secretary in the Ministry of Road Transport and Highways (MoRTH).
- The Appointments Committee of the Cabinet (ACC) approved his appointment on a contract basis.
- NITI Aayog (National Institution for Transforming India) is the premier policy think tank of the Government of India, formed in 2015.
